After focusing solely on the Chuck 70 and the One Star, Tyler, The Creator’s Golf Le Fleur imprint and Converse are now turning their attention to a completely new model to kick off their collaborative partnership in 2025.
The One Star Slip Pro is a skate-minded silhouette, but with obvious casual wear capability. Featuring hairy suede uppers in three distinct offerings of Forest Elf, Black Beauty, and Forget Me Not, this trio of One Star Slip Pros feature the die-cut Star logo on the heel for the added style hit.
While Tyler’s footwear offerings typically pull from more lofty inspirations, here “grassy landscapes” are the guiding light, literally materializing with the viridescent pair and more abstractly inspiring the black and blue. Size-up pop lettering stamping the Golf Logo takes up the left insole on each shoe for one last bit of detailing. On a performance and comfort standpoint, Converse utilizes CX Foam on the interior as well as CONS traction rubber for better grip and board-feel.
Though the lack of more visible branding is a bit surprising, we expect that to change once the brand explores the silhouette deeper.
